Seeds of the hybrid cauliflower variety, ‘Sonia’ (Doctor Seeds Pvt. Ltd., Ludhiana, India), from the March maturity group and suitable for the latewinter season, were used by farmers for planting both treatments. Seeds were planted at a rate of 0.3e0.4 kg seed/ha. For the non-IPM treatment, seeds were treated with carbendazim 50 WP at 1 g a.i./kg seed. For the IPM treatment, seeds were treated with T. harzianum at 4 g/kg of seed, and by imidacloprid 70 WS at 3.5 g a.i./kg of seed for management of P. debaryanum and L. erysimi, respectively.
